Thomas Cranmer, 1489-1556, leader of the English Reformation

6040067 Thomas Cranmer, 1489-1556, leader of the English Reformation. by Bry, Theodor de (1528-98); Private Collection; (add.info.: Thomas Cranmer, 1489-1556, leader of the English Reformation and Archbishop of Canterbury during the reigns of Henry VIII, Edward VI and Mary I. Thomas Cramerus, Archiepiscopus Cantuarienfis, Primas Anglicus. Copperplate engraving by Johann Theodore de Bry from Jean-Jacques Boissards Bibliotheca Chalcographica, Johann Ammonius, Frankfurt, 1650.); © Florilegius

E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ases Thomas Cranmer, a prominent figure in the English Reformation. Born in 1489 and passing away in 1556, Cranmer played a pivotal role as the Archbishop of Canterbury during the reigns of Henry VIII, Edward VI, and Mary I. His influence on religious reform was profound. The image depicts Cranmer with an air of wisdom and determination. The copperplate engraving by Johann Theodore de Bry beautifully captures his essence. This portrait is part of Jean-Jacques Boissard's Bibliotheca Chalcographica collection from Frankfurt in 1650. Cranmer's leadership during turbulent times shaped the course of Christianity in England. He championed Protestant ideals and worked tirelessly to establish reforms within the Church.
